It was my dear parents wedding anniversary and I wanted to share a little about them as I felt it was fit and right to do so . Sadly they are both long gone but I remember them with much love and happiness. My parents had been friends for a long time. My mum went on to get engaged to someone else, an Canadian Airman in fact. Sadly he was killed in world war two and it took her some time to get over losing him.
She started going out in a big group and my dad was part of that group. After awhile he said "lets have a party" and when asked why he said that they may as well get married lol.
It started a very long marriage which was for the most happy . It gave me a fab childhood with a ton of memories of good times. Even though they passed away a long time ago, I still miss them but I can smile at all the wonderful fun times we had, and I am blessed to have had them as parents.
